Venue | Sardar Patel Stadium, Motera, Ahmedabad on 15th May 2014 (20-over match) (day/night) |
Balls per over | 6 |
Toss | Delhi Daredevils won the toss and decided to field |
Result | Rajasthan Royals won by 62 runs |
Points | Delhi Daredevils 0; Rajasthan Royals 2 |
Umpires | S Ravi, RJ Tucker (Australia) |
TV umpire | K Srinath |
Referee | AJ Pycroft (Zimbabwe) |
Reserve Umpire | KN Ananthapadmanabhan |
Man of the Match | AM Rahane |

Notes
--> Rajasthan Royals powerplay 1: overs 1 to 6 (52/1)
--> Delhi Daredevils powerplay 1: overs 1 to 6 (34/2)
--> Rajasthan Royals innings: 50 in 5.6 overs
--> Rajasthan Royals innings: 100 in 11.3 overs
--> Rajasthan Royals innings: 150 in 15.4 overs
--> Rajasthan Royals innings: 200 in 19.5 overs
--> Delhi Daredevils innings: 50 in 8 overs
--> Delhi Daredevils innings: 100 in 16.1 overs
--> BCJ Cutting made his debut in Indian Premier League matches
--> LRPL Taylor made his last appearance in Indian Premier League matches
--> RA Shukla made his last appearance in Indian Premier League matches
--> AM Rahane 50 in 45 balls with 7 fours
--> KK Cooper passed his previous highest score of 26 in Indian Premier League matches
--> KK Cooper passed his previous highest score of 28 in Twenty20 matches
--> MK Tiwary 50 in 39 balls with 5 fours and 1 six
--> BCJ Cutting made his debut for Rajasthan Royals in Twenty20 matches
--> Imran Tahir reached 100 wickets in Twenty20 matches when he dismissed STR Binny, his 1st wicket in the Rajasthan Royals innings
--> S Nadeem reached 50 wickets in Twenty20 matches when he dismissed KK Nair, his 1st wicket in the Rajasthan Royals innings
--> AM Rahane (15) and SV Samson (37) added 50 in 30 balls for the Rajasthan Royals 3rd wicket
